python 数据写入到csv文件
时间: 2023-09-26 09:06:46 浏览: 51
好的,这里是使用Python将数据写入CSV文件的示例代码:
```python
import csv
# 要写入CSV文件的数据
data = [
['Tom', '28', 'Male'],
['Lucy', '23', 'Female'],
['Jack', '31', 'Male']
]
# 打开文件,设置文件名和写入模式
with open('example.csv', 'w', newline='') as csvfile:
# 创建写入器
writer = csv.writer(csvfile)
# 写入数据
for row in data:
writer.writerow(row)
```
上面的代码将一个包含三行数据的二维数组写入到名为`example.csv`的CSV文件中。其中,`csv.writer`函数用来创建一个写入器,该写入器可以写入CSV格式的数据到文件中去。在每次循环中,`writer.writerow`方法会将一行数据写入到CSV文件中。
希望这个例子可以帮助到你!
相关问题
python数据写入csv文件
好的,下面是Python写入CSV文件的示例代码:
```python
import csv
# 定义数据
data = [
['Alice', 18, 'female'],
['Bob', 22, 'male'],
['Charlie', 25, 'male']
]
# 打开文件,若文件不存在则创建
with open('data.csv', 'w', newline='') as file:
# 创建写入器
writer = csv.writer(file)
# 写入表头
writer.writerow(['name', 'age', 'gender'])
# 写入数据
writer.writerows(data)
print('写入完成')
```
这个示例代码会将 `data` 列表中的数据写入到名为 `data.csv` 的CSV文件中,并包含表头行。你可以根据需要修改数据和文件名。
在python怎样将数据写入到csv文件
你可以使用Python内置的csv模块来将数据写入到csv文件。首先,你需要打开一个csv文件并创建一个csv写入器对象。然后,你可以使用写入器对象的writerow()方法将数据写入到文件中。下面是一个示例代码:
```python
import csv
# 打开csv文件并创建写入器对象
with open('data.csv', 'w', newline='') as csvfile:
writer = csv.writer(csvfile)
# 写入数据
writer.writerow(['姓名', '年龄', '性别'])
writer.writerow(['张三', 18, '男'])
writer.writerow(['李四', 20, '女'])
```
在这个示例中,我们打开了一个名为"data.csv"的文件,并创建了一个csv写入器对象。然后,我们使用writerow()方法将数据写入到文件中。注意,我们在打开文件时使用了"newline=''"参数,这是为了避免在Windows系统中出现额外的空行。
当你运行这个代码后,你将会在当前目录下看到一个名为"data.csv"的文件,其中包含了我们写入的数据。